Foreign specialists were involved in the national team's preparation for the World Cup.

The Uzbekistan national football team is actively continuing its preparations for the upcoming World Cup. This was reported by Zamin.uz.
As a crucial stage of preparation, participation in the FIFA Series tournament is planned within the framework of the training camp to be held in March. To organize preparation for this serious competition even more effectively, experienced specialists recognized on an international level are being recruited to the team's medical department.
These steps are of decisive importance in maintaining our players' physical condition and preventing injuries. One of the key specialists joining the medical staff is Enrico Castellacci, a renowned physician in the fields of sports medicine and orthopedics.
He has demonstrated his professional expertise while serving for many years as the main doctor of the Italian national team. Furthermore, during his career, Castellacci has held responsible positions such as President of the Italian Football Doctors Association and Vice-President of the Italian National Orthopedic-Traumatologists Association.
His arrival provides the team with an opportunity to implement modern medical approaches. Additionally, Simeone Siciliano, a qualified Italian physiotherapist, has also been added to the team roster.
He possesses experience gained from successful work at prestigious clubs such as Palermo, Salernitana, and Benevento. Siciliano's addition will make a significant contribution to accelerating the players' recovery process after training and properly directing their physical strength.
